Reiss excerpts the following quote from the ESPN interview:
Management philosophy: “We try to hire managers in our different businesses that we trust, have good judgment, and we also want them to be bold and be willing to do things that other people aren’t willing to do. The only way they can do that is if they feel they have the support of the people they work with. When you take risks, very often they don’t work out. But understanding why the risk was taken, and at that moment with the information available why they made the decision to do it, we support it. ... How are you ever going to sustain success year in and year out? You have to be willing to do things that the other 31 teams don’t want to do.”
